Chicken Strips in Cheese Batter
Ingredients
- Skin-On Chicken Breasts 20 oz
- Farm fresh eggs 4 pieces
- Paprika 1 teaspoon
- Salt to taste
- Parsley 1 bunch
- Cheese Spread 5 oz
- Wheat Flour 2 teaspoons
Step-by-Step Guide
Step 1
Rinse the chicken breast, dry it with a paper towel, and cut it into small strips.
Step 2
Place the strips in a deep bowl and add salt.
Step 3
Add ground paprika.
Step 4
Mix well and mash. Let it sit for 15 minutes.
Step 5
Meanwhile, prepare the batter. Finely chop the parsley.
Step 6
Crack the eggs into a bowl and add salt to taste.
Step 7
Add the chopped parsley to the eggs and mix well until smooth.
Step 8
Gradually add the flour to avoid lumps. The batter should have a consistency similar to pancake batter.
Step 9
Grate the cheese on a coarse grater.
Step 10
Add the prepared mixture and cheese to the chicken, mix well, and let it sit for another 10–15 minutes.
Step 11
Heat a skillet well, adding sunflower oil. Place the pieces of chicken, making sure to leave space between them. Fry on both sides for 5–10 minutes until cooked through.
Step 12
The finished strips can be served either hot or cold.
